Code Duplication    Length = 9-9 lines in 2 locations

src/Stream/StreamModel.php 2 locations

@@ 132-140 (lines=9) @@
129
                    $fieldModel        = new FieldModel();
130
                    $fieldTranslations = new EloquentCollection();
131
132
                    if (isset($assignment['field']['translations'])) {
133
                        foreach (array_pull($assignment['field'], 'translations') as $attributes) {
134
                            $translation = new FieldModelTranslation();
135
                            $translation->setRawAttributes($attributes);
136
137
                            $fieldTranslations->push($translation);
138
                        }
139
                    }
140
141
                    $assignment['field']['config'] = serialize($assignment['field']['config']);
142
143
                    $fieldModel->setRawAttributes($assignment['field']);
@@ 152-160 (lines=9) @@
149
                    $assignmentModel        = new AssignmentModel();
150
                    $assignmentTranslations = new EloquentCollection();
151
152
                    if (isset($assignment['translations'])) {
153
                        foreach (array_pull($assignment, 'translations') as $attributes) {
154
                            $translation = new AssignmentModelTranslation();
155
                            $translation->setRawAttributes($attributes);
156
157
                            $assignmentTranslations->push($translation);
158
                        }
159
                    }
160
161
                    $assignmentModel->setRawAttributes($assignment);
162
                    $assignmentModel->setRawAttributes($assignment);
163